Find the value of r so the line that passes through (-3,2) and (3,r) has a slope of -1/2

Step-by-step explanation:

gradient = (y2 - y1)/(x2 - x1)

-1/2 = (r - 2)/(3 - (-3))

-1/2 = (r - 2)/6

-1/2(6) = r - 2

-3 = r - 2

-3 + 2 = r

hence r = -1.
